Description
Moroccan sabre, known as a nimcha. Horn hilt. Wrought-iron fittings, gilded. Guard featuring a knuckle arch and three prongs. Curved blade with a full blood groove, engraved over two-thirds of its length. Velvet-lined scabbard with two chiselled, silver-plated brass fittings. EM (wear and tear, pitting, damage)
